Lately, the rise in popularity of house daycare services was on the rise. With more and more moms and dads seeking flexible and affordable childcare choices, residence daycare providers have become a favorite choice for numerous people. But as with any type of childcare arrangement, there are both benefits and drawbacks to take into account when it comes to home daycare.

One of the main great things about home daycare could be the personalized attention and care that young ones obtain. Unlike larger daycare centers, residence daycare providers routinely have smaller groups of kiddies to care for, letting them give each young one much more individualized interest. This is often especially beneficial for kids which might need additional support or have unique requirements. Additionally, home daycare providers frequently have more mobility in their schedules, allowing them to accommodate the needs of working parents who may have non-traditional work hours.

Another advantage of home daycare may be the home-like environment that kiddies are able to experience. In a property daycare setting, kids can play and find out in an appropriate and familiar environment, which can help all of them feel more secure and relaxed. This is specially very theraputic for youngsters which may have a problem with separation anxiety whenever becoming left in a more substantial, more institutionalized daycare setting.

Residence daycare providers in addition frequently have more versatility about curriculum and activities. In a house daycare setting, providers possess freedom to modify their particular programs towards the certain needs and passions of the young ones in their attention. This might permit more imaginative and individualized understanding experiences, that can easily be beneficial for young ones of all ages.

Despite these advantages, additionally there are some drawbacks to consider in terms of home daycare. One of many problems that moms and dads may have could be the lack of oversight and legislation in home daycare facilities. Unlike bigger daycare centers, which can be subject to strict certification demands and laws, home daycare providers may not be held into the exact same requirements. This might boost concerns towards high quality and security of attention that kiddies receive in these settings.

Another potential downside of home daycare could be the minimal socialization possibilities that young ones might have. In a house daycare environment, kids are typically only getting a little band of colleagues, that may perhaps not give them exactly the same amount of socialization and contact with diverse experiences which they would receive in a bigger daycare center. This could be a problem for moms and dads just who price socialization and peer relationship as essential aspects of their child's development.

Furthermore, house daycare providers may face difficulties with regards to managing their caregiving duties with regards to individual everyday lives. Numerous house daycare providers are self-employed that can find it difficult to get a hold of a work-life balance, particularly if they've been taking care of young ones in their own domiciles. This could easily cause burnout and anxiety, which could eventually affect the caliber of attention that young ones receive.

Overall, home daycare is an excellent selection for people looking versatile and personalized childcare choices. However, it is very important for parents to carefully think about the benefits and drawbacks of residence daycare before making a decision.
